### Changelog — Farepost Rules Engine v3.1

Heads up, on-call folks: we changed the defaults for the shipping fee rules engine. Rules now evaluate in priority order instead of insertion order, and the fallback fee kicks in after 200ms instead of hanging forever. If merchants complain about unexpected flat-rate charges, that's probably the new timeout doing its job — check evaluation latency before rolling anything back. The defaults now in effect are listed here.

config for kafof-bawef:
holath:
  log_level: debug
  metrics_host: metrics.holath.qorvelsys.internal
  pin: 2191
  pool_size: 32

Ticket: GridWit preview env is busted. Hey newcomers, good starter ticket! The crossword generator's preview environment keeps serving stale puzzles because someone pointed CACHE_URL at the retired cache cluster. Swap it to the new cluster hostname in the .env file and redeploy. While you're in there, the puzzle-dictionary service credential was wiped during the last rebuild, so re-add it on the line right after CACHE_URL.

vault entry, yahif-yajep: COURIER_KEY29=b802bdf8034096b65a51c6ba5abe2

## Releases

SketchRelay ships a tagged build every second Thursday. The undo/redo subsystem is the riskiest area this cycle: the new branching history model changes how redo states serialize, so release notes must flag the migration. Before tagging, run the history replay suite and confirm round-trip fidelity on the large fixture diagrams. Builds are published to the internal channel only after the verifier accepts the artifact signature. All release artifacts are signed with the team key shown below.

deploy key for kajof-yawif: bky9_fvxrpdHPq

Subject: Replica lag alarm — mostly tamed

Hey on-call: the Gravelfen read-replica lag alarm was firing all weekend thanks to a chunky backfill job. We've throttled the writer and bumped the alert threshold slightly. If it pages again tonight, just ack and ping the data team channel. The patched build carries the token below.

pipeline stamp: htk9_ce63042d9